Archilochus
Archilochus (; ''Arkhílokhos''; 680 – c. 645 BC) some scholars disagree; for instance,
Robin Lane Fox (2008) dates him c. 740–680 BC.}} was a
iambic poet of the
Archaic period from the island of
Paros. He is celebrated for his versatile and innovative use of poetic meters, and is the earliest known Greek author to compose almost entirely on the theme of his own emotions and experiences.
